wordpress数据库优化,wordpress减少数据库查询——

beiqi cms教程 20

本文目录一览:

wordpress百万级数据如何优化数据库

WordPress核心优化使用缓存插件:推荐使用WP Rocket(付费)、LiteSpeed Cache(免费)或W3 Total Cache等缓存插件。这些插件可以配置页面缓存、浏览器缓存、数据库缓存,并生成静态HTML文件,从而显著提高网站加载速度。数据库优化:定期清理冗余数据,如旧文章修订版本、垃圾评论和过期临时数据。

wordpress数据库优化,wordpress减少数据库查询——-第1张图片-增云技术工坊
(图片来源网络,侵删)

自动化配置:通过控制面板启用缓存、CDN、数据库优化等功能。持续监控与建议:内置性能分析工具实时监控速度指标,并提供优化建议。综上所述,Websoft9 的优化方案从服务器底层架构到应用层优化,全面提升了 WordPress 网站的速度和性能,为站长们提供了高效、便捷的解决方案。

该插件“实现Object的分级持久化缓存,可以用来代替内置WordPress的WP_Object_Cache。”不像其他缓存插件,该插件不缓存你的整个页面,它只缓存在插件的API函数中指定的数据。换句话说,它会明显减少您的数据库的负载,从而加快页面加载和增加你的博客的整体性能。

wordpress数据库优化,wordpress减少数据库查询——-第2张图片-增云技术工坊
(图片来源网络,侵删)

优化代码和数据库:使用Autoptimize插件合并和压缩CSS、JS文件,减少HTTP请求次数。定期使用WP-Optimize插件清理数据库中的垃圾数据。检查优化效果 使用设备模拟器测试:在WordPress后台的【外观】【自定义】中选择“设备预览”,或使用Google Chrome浏览器的设备模拟功能,查看网站在不同设备上的展示效果。

使用WP Rocket插件,可以显著提升WordPress网站的速度和性能,通过优化代码、文件和缓存页面来实现。WP Rocket包含多种功能,如延迟加载图像、预加载字体、优化数据库和关键CSS。以下是安装和激活WP Rocket的步骤:购买WP Rocket插件许可。下载插件安装包(ZIP文件)。

wordpress数据库优化,wordpress减少数据库查询——-第3张图片-增云技术工坊
(图片来源网络,侵删)

数据库存储优化对于大量数据,可考虑使用自定义数据库表,通过wpdb类直接操作,提升性能。关键注意事项默认值处理:get_option()需提供默认空数组,避免首次加载时报错。数组检查:访问数组元素前,使用isset()和is_array()确保安全性。空值过滤:消毒时使用array_filter()移除无效数据。

WordPress为什么会报500错误-WordPress报500错误的缘由

1、WordPress报500错误通常由服务器配置、主题/插件冲突、数据库问题、文件损坏或服务器负载过高引发。以下是具体原因及解决方法wordpress数据库优化:常见原因服务器配置问题 PHP版本过低wordpress数据库优化:WordPress对PHP版本有最低要求(如PHP 4+)wordpress数据库优化,版本过低会导致兼容性问题。

2、WordPress报500错误通常由插件冲突、主题问题、.htaccess文件损坏、PHP内存限制不足或文件权限错误导致,可通过禁用插件、切换主题、修复配置文件、调整内存限制或检查权限解决。常见原因及解决方法插件冲突 原因:多个插件功能或代码不兼容,尤其是更新后可能引发冲突。

3、WordPress报500错误wordpress数据库优化的主要原因可归纳为以下方面:服务器配置问题服务器内存不足是常见诱因。WordPress运行时需占用系统资源,若内存分配不足,会导致进程崩溃。此外,PHP版本不兼容(如版本过低无法支持新功能)或服务器负载过高(如并发请求过多导致处理能力饱和),均可能引发500错误。

4、检查服务器日志HTTP 500错误通常是服务器端问题,首先查看服务器错误日志(如Apache的error_log或IIS的日志文件),定位具体错误原因。日志可能显示PHP脚本超时、内存不足或权限问题等。排查插件和主题冲突 禁用所有插件:通过FTP或文件管理器重命名/wp-content/plugins/文件夹为plugins_old,刷新网站。

5、原因:有时候,安装的插件或主题可能与WordPress的某些功能冲突,导致500错误。步骤:通过FTP或文件管理器进入WordPress安装目录。将wp-content/plugins文件夹中的插件名字修改一下(例如,在插件文件夹名后加.bak),使所有插件禁用。重新访问网站,如果错误消失,说明某个插件导致了问题。

WordPress出现“建立数据库连接时出错”如何解决

WordPress出现“建立数据库连接时出错”可通过以下步骤排查和解决:该问题通常由数据库通信失败引发,按顺序检查配置、服务状态、数据库完整性及插件/主题冲突,多数情况可快速恢复。检查wp-config.php文件中的数据库配置WordPress通过根目录下的wp-config.php文件连接数据库,若其中信息错误会导致连接失败。

第一步,检查MySQL数据库服务状态。登录数据库服务器执行命令,查询数据库服务状态。若显示active (running),数据库服务正常;若显示inactive (dead),则需启动服务,执行启动命令。若启动过程出现ERROR,需根据报错信息修改数据库服务配置,重新启动。第二步,测试MySQL数据库连接。

遇到WordPress建立数据库连接时出错的情况,通常需要检查几个关键步骤。首先,检查wp-config.php文件,确认数据库账号、密码和地址填写是否正确。若信息无误,尝试更改数据库密码。发现选项中包含加密模式,尝试设置为41位,同时保留原密码,这样无需更改config文件,刷新网站后,问题解决。

如何禁用WordPress修订版本?关闭文章修订?

禁用WordPress修订版本的方法完全禁用wordpress数据库优化:在wp-config.php文件中添加以下代码:define(WP_POST_REVISIONSwordpress数据库优化, false);此代码会彻底关闭文章修订功能wordpress数据库优化,避免生成任何历史版本。

要想禁用文章修订版,可以在 wp-config.php文件中添加:1 define(WP_POST_REVISIONS, false);删除文章修订版 禁用wordpress数据库优化了文章修订版之后,数据库中还是保存着之前已经创建的文章修订版,这些其实已经没多大用处,而且占着ID,我们可以将它删除。

关闭WordPress的版本修订功能 WordPress会自动保存文章的各个修订版本,如果文章量大,且文章经常修改的话,会导致数据库变得臃肿,建议取消。可将下列代码放置到WordPress根目录下的 wp-config.php 文件,来取消版本修订功能。

定期清理冗余数据,如旧文章修订版本、垃圾评论和过期临时数据。使用插件(如WP-Optimize)或phpMyAdmin等工具优化数据库表。禁用无用功能:关闭XML-RPC(易受攻击且多数用户无需使用)。禁用Emojis、Embeds、REST API(若不需要)。可以使用插件(如Disable Bloat for WordPress)来简化这些设置。

在“预加载”选项卡中,允许插件使用站点地图构建缓存,或关闭预加载以避免影响首次加载体验。 通过“高级规则”选项卡控制哪些页面不应缓存,排除特定cookie、用户代理和自动重建缓存的页面。 清理WordPress数据库,删除不再需要的帖子修订、草稿、垃圾邮件和评论。

标签: wordpress数据库优化

发布评论 0条评论)

  • Refresh code

还木有评论哦,快来抢沙发吧~